Transaction 642424d75c10829cdd5ede27c8e78106329fc01c80a9bf8ff16481a3694ba2bf

2 Input
1 Outputs
  • 642424d75c10829cdd5ede27c8e78106329fc01c80a9bf8ff16481a3694ba2bf:0
  • value  291738
    address  1FxszjnKrwg9M4rwACgbMikE4ysVu7fcFW